Hey,
I have recently had a small problem with my 08 CRF450 engine locking solid. I am unsure what is happening inside i am going to pull the engine aprat this week.
Basicly what happens is i turn it off and sumtimes maybe 1 in 40 start attempts it just becomes impossible to kick over or tow start. (Kinda fun to drag around the padock like sled tho) and will stay that way till you rock it back and fourth.
When it runs it runs mint has more power then a standard 450 has a small rattle but im sure thats the timming chain which i am going to fit this week. I have been doing piston and rings every 50 hours
I have had the bike from new has done 140 hours.
Pulling the clutch in dosent help so im pretty sure its not gear box. I have done 20 hours of riding since i noticed it and im finnaly sick of it.

Mate, take it from me, I can guarantee that your auto Decompressor shaft pin has either broken off completely, or alternatively bent beyond functionality, It is an easy fix and one that Honda should come to the party with, as its a known recall in the states and should be one here as well.
scott411
12th July 2010, 09:12
the CRF450 09 had a recall with the decompressor as above, never heard of the 08 having been recalled, and when the 09 one went it went completly, it was not only sumtimes,
sounds like something to do with the decompressor through

dump the oils and see if you get any metals or metallic coming out. You'll soon know if its gearbox or not. It could be that the decomp is not adjusted properly. have you noticed if its jamming when hot and comes right when cold?
7mmWSM
13th July 2010, 22:30
also the knocking is more likely the cam tensioner rather than the chain but I would replace both myself and also inspect the bottom end for play
